Barratt David Wilson Homes’ Southampton division, has achieved the top 5 star rating and no other housebuilder comes close to matching that record. To mark the achievement parent company Barratt Redrow is donating £25,000 to the Construction Youth Trust, to help more young people have careers in construction and the built environment. e number of stars a housebuilder receives is based on customer responses to the question “would you recommend your builder to a friend”? For Barratt to have been awarded 5 stars means that over 90% of its customers would recommend their homes to a friend. e HBF New Homes Survey is one of the largest surveys of its type in the country, with around 50,000 people taking part in it who have recently bought a new build home. e simple 1-5 star rating system was developed to give customers an easy to view ranking of which housebuilders have the most satis ed customers. Neil Je erson, Chief Executive of the Home Builders Federation, says: “This year’s survey results highlight the industry’s absolute commitment to delivering high levels of customer service, and compare favourably to satisfaction levels seen in any other sectors or products. Customers are the ultimate judges of performance and so receiving such high scores based on their feedback alone is a significant achievement. These results are a testament to the dedication and hard work of the entire home-building workforce, from on-site teams to the boardroom.” e new 5 star rating comes on top of Barratt’s success at the NHBC Pride in the Job Quality Awards. e competition is known as the ‘Oscars’ of the housebuilding industry, with over 11,000 site managers being entered into it. Last year Barratt’s site managers won 89 Pride in the Job Quality Awards, more than any other housebuilder for a record 20 years in a row.
